Why Solvang Properties See Mold Issues

Solvang sits in the Santa Ynez Valley at roughly 480 feet elevation, where marine air funnels inland through the Gaviota Pass corridor on late-afternoon and overnight cycles. That daily humidity swing — warm and dry by noon, cool and damp by midnight — creates persistent condensation on cold surfaces inside buildings that aren’t well-ventilated. Older commercial and residential structures along Mission Drive and the surrounding residential streets were often built with minimal vapor barriers, because mid-century construction codes in Santa Barbara County didn’t require them the way modern California Title 24 energy standards do.

The result is a pattern we see repeatedly: mold colonies hidden behind decorative wainscoting, inside closets on exterior walls, and beneath bathroom tile set over older mortar beds that have slowly absorbed ground moisture. Crawl spaces are especially vulnerable here — the valley floor soil retains moisture from winter rains well into spring, and an unencapsulated crawl space can read 80–90% relative humidity even during a dry stretch in April.

Our Mold Remediation Process in Solvang

Every job starts with a thorough visual inspection and moisture mapping. We use thermal imaging cameras and calibrated moisture meters to locate wet building materials that aren’t visible to the eye — because in Solvang’s older homes, the source of a mold colony is often two rooms away from where the smell is strongest.

Once we’ve identified the affected zones, we establish negative-air containment using 6-mil poly barriers and HEPA-filtered air scrubbers. This keeps mold spores from migrating to unaffected areas of the home during the removal process. Contaminated porous materials — drywall, insulation, wood framing with surface mold — are removed, bagged, and disposed of per California Department of Public Health guidelines. Non-porous surfaces are cleaned with EPA-registered antimicrobial agents and allowed to dry to verified moisture levels before any reconstruction begins.

We document every step with photographs and moisture readings, which matters when you’re working with a homeowner’s insurance claim or a property management company that needs a written scope of work.

Solvang Insurance Coordination

Mold remediation claims in California hinge on demonstrating a covered water loss as the proximate cause — a burst supply line, a roof leak, an appliance failure. We photograph the moisture source, the affected materials, and the mold growth in sequence, then produce a written scope of work formatted to meet most major carriers’ documentation requirements. We bill insurance directly on covered losses, which means you aren’t fronting the full remediation cost out of pocket while waiting for reimbursement.

If your insurer disputes coverage or requests an independent moisture assessment, we can coordinate with a third-party industrial hygienist for pre- and post-remediation air quality testing — a step that also satisfies the documentation requirements some Santa Barbara County property transactions now request during escrow.

Local Note

One pattern worth knowing if you own an older property in Solvang: many of the residential and mixed-use buildings constructed in the 1950s and 1960s to support the town’s growing Danish-themed tourism economy used redwood framing and sheathing, which is naturally resistant to decay but not immune to mold when moisture levels stay elevated long enough. Redwood’s tight grain can mask early-stage mold growth that would be obvious on pine or OSB — the surface looks clean while the fungal network is already established in the wood fibers. We probe and test rather than assume, which is the only reliable approach with that building stock.

If you’ve noticed a musty smell in a Solvang home that doesn’t have obvious water damage, that’s often the tell. Is mold remediation in Solvang typically covered by homeowners insurance?
Coverage depends on the cause — most policies cover mold that results from a sudden, accidental water loss like a burst pipe or appliance leak, but exclude mold from long-term seepage or maintenance neglect. We document the moisture source and affected materials in a format most major carriers accept, and we bill insurance directly on covered losses so you're not paying the full cost upfront.
How does the Santa Ynez Valley's climate affect how long mold remediation takes in Solvang?
The valley's pattern of cool, humid nights and warm days means building materials can re-absorb ambient moisture during the drying phase if containment isn't maintained carefully. We monitor interior relative humidity throughout the drying process and don't close out a job until moisture readings in structural materials hit target levels — rushing that step is the most common reason mold returns after remediation.
Do Solvang property transactions require post-remediation air quality testing?
There's no universal Santa Barbara County ordinance requiring it, but it's increasingly common for buyers' agents and lenders to request a clearance report during escrow when a prior mold event is disclosed. We can coordinate with an independent industrial hygienist for post-remediation air sampling, which produces a third-party clearance letter that satisfies most transaction requirements and gives the new owner a clean baseline.
